Cyclomatic Complexity• Cyclomatic complexity is a popular procedural software metric equal
to the number of decisions that can be taken in a procedure.
• Concretely, in C# the CC of a method is the number of following expressions found in the body of the method:
if | while | for | foreach | case | default | continue | goto | && | || | catch | ternary operator ?: | ??
• Following expressions are not counted for CC computation:
else | do | switch | try | using | throw | finally | return | object creation | method call | field access
SELECT METHODS WHERE CyclomaticComplexity > 20SELECT METHODS WHERE ILCyclomaticComplexity > 25
WARN If Count > 0 IN SELECT METHODS WHERE NbLinesOfCode > 20 AND CyclomaticComplexity > 8

Introduction to levelization• Central design principle:
Getting rid of dependency cycles between components
• A and B belongs to a dependency cycles: – They can’t be developed and tested independently– They are an indivisible unit– They constitute a super component
• Diseconomy of scale phenomenon: one super component costs more than several smaller components.
• Right size for a component : 500 to 2000 LOC

State and mutability: Definition of immutable types• Immutable types: types where instances’ state cannot be modified once
created.
• A stateless type (i.e a type without any instance field) is considered as immutable.
• A type with at least one non-private instance field is considered as mutable (because such a field can be eventually modified outside the type).
• A class that derives directly or indirectly from a mutable type is considered as mutable.
• Enumeration, static type, type defined in framework assemblies and delegate classes are never considered as immutable.
• Particularly, classes that derive directly or indirectly from a class defined in a tier assembly that is not the System.Object class, is never considered as immutable.

CQL facilities for State and mutability• Ensuring that the type Namespace.Foo is immutable:
WARN IF Count != 1 IN SELECT TYPES WHERE ! IsImmutable AND FulleNameIs "Namespace.Foo"
• Matching methods that breaks immutability (i.e that modifies instance fields):SELECT METHODS FROM TYPES "Namespace.Foo" WHERE ChangesObjectState AND !IsConstructor
• Matching methods that modifies static fields:SELECT METHODS FROM TYPES "Namespace.Foo" WHERE ChangesTypeState AND !IsClassConstructor
• Matching methods that modifies a particular field:SELECT METHODS FROM TYPES "Namespace.Foo" WHERE IsDirectlyWritingField "Namespace.Foo.m_Field"

Naming Conventions• Instance fields should begin with m_
WARN If Count > 0 IN
SELECT FIELDS WHERE ! NameLike "^m_" AND ! IsStatic
• Interface name should begin with I
WARN If Count > 0 IN SELECT TYPES
WHERE IsInterface AND !NameLike "^I" AND !IsNested
• Types names should begin with an upper letter:
WARN If Count > 0 IN SELECT TYPES
WHERE !NameLike "^[A-Z] "
• Exception class should be suffixed with ‘Exception’
WARN If Count > 0 IN SELECT TYPES
WHERE IsExceptionClass AND !NameLike"Exception$"
or
WHERE DeriveFrom "System.Exception"
AND !NameLike "Exception$"
